Abstract(in English) Collision avoidance radar system for automobile is important use case of millimeter wave radar. For realizing extremely high-resolution radar system is also required for various infrastructure surveillance systems. Since the spatial resolution scales with the wavelength, it is advantageous to use millimeter-wave frequencies for high-resolution radars. In addition to small wavelength, 90GHz-band frequencies has relatively small absorption loss compared with 60GHz-band frequencies. We will report system architecture of the system, recent evaluation results for wide-band chirp signal generation and EVM measurement.
